The Tabernacle Choir Announces Next Stop on World Tour Florida and Georgia, September 2024

brooklyn tabernacle choir tour 2023

The Tabernacle Choir and Orchestra at Temple Square are pleased to announce the third stop on their world tour of “Hope.” The Choir will travel to Florida and Georgia for three concerts September 5–12, 2024, for the North America Southeast leg of their tour. Guest artists are expected to join the Choir and will be announced at a later date.

The Choir will kick off its tour in Florida, near Fort Lauderdale, on September 7. The Choir will then move on to Georgia, where it will perform with Morehouse College. In October 2023, the Choir hosted the talented glee clubs from Morehouse College and Spelman College in Salt Lake City, where the two groups performed on the Choir’s weekly television, radio, and internet broadcast of Music & the Spoken Word.

Choir president Michael O. Leavitt said, “When the Morehouse College and Spelman College glee clubs performed with The Tabernacle Choir in Salt Lake City, the music was unforgettable. When these great choir organizations perform together, the result is both beautiful and culturally significant.”

The concerts are free to the public, but tickets are required. Ticketing information will be available at a later date.

Over the next four years, The Tabernacle Choir and Orchestra will travel twice a year to different parts of the world. Leavitt said, “Our goal is to magnify the Choir’s impact throughout the world by helping people feel God’s love for His children.”

Tabernacle Choir, Orchestra in Florida for first concert of southeastern U.S. ‘Songs of Hope’ tour stop

Latin music greeted tabernacle choir and orchestra members in florida, plus see photos from the rehearsal.

brooklyn tabernacle choir tour 2023

By Church News

SUNRISE, Florida — Latin music welcomed The Tabernacle Choir and Orchestra at Temple Square members as they arrived earlier this week in southeastern Florida this week to begin the Florida and Georgia stops on the multicity, multiyear “Songs of Hope” tour.

Their first concert Saturday, Sept. 7, 7 p.m. Eastern time, at the Amerant Bank Arena in Sunrise, Florida, will feature Adassa, who has won Golden Globe, Oscar and Grammy awards and is known at the voice of Delores in “Encanto;” and Alex Melecio, who is also one of the Spanish language  hosts for “Music & the Spoken Word.”  Both performed with the choir and orchestra during the tour  stop in Mexico  in June 2023 and during the  summer concert in July 2023 .

The bilingual concert will feature music and dialogue in Spanish and English that reflect the Latin traditions in Florida and the southeastern United States.

The Tabernacle Choir at Temple Square and Orchestra at Temple Square’s next stops in the “Songs of Hope” are in southern Florida on Saturday, Sept. 7, at Amerant Bank Arena, in Sunrise, Florida, near Fort Lauderdale, and in Atlanta, Georgia, on Sept. 9 at Morehouse College and Sept. 11 at the State Farm Arena.

The free arena performances on Sept. 7 and Sept. 11 will also be livestreamed to watch parties in homes, meetinghouses of The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ints, and community centers in Alabama, Arkansas, Florida, Georgia, southern Indiana, Kentucky, Louisiana, Mississippi, Missouri, Tennessee, North Carolina and South Carolina. Both are at 7 p.m. Eastern time, or 5 p.m. Mountain time.

The concerts are also available on the Tabernacle Choir’s YouTube channel, the Church’s broadcast page at broadcasts.churchofjesuschrist.org and the Gospel Stream app. See choirworldtour.com for information.

Concert guest artists

Singers Adassa, who has won Golden Globe, Oscar and Grammy awards, and is best known as the voice of Delores in “Encanto,” and Alex Melecio, who is also one of the Spanish language hosts for “Music & the Spoken Word,” are the guest artists at the concert in Florida. Both performed with the choir and orchestra during the “Hope” tour stop in Mexico in June 2023 and during the summer concert in July 2023.

In Atlanta, the choir and orchestra will perform with the glee clubs from Morehouse College and Spelman College. In October 2023, the choir hosted the glee clubs in Salt Lake City, where the two groups performed on the choir’s weekly broadcast of “Music & the Spoken Word.”

The New Order: Last Days of Europe Wiki

Omsk , officially the Siberian Black League , is a warlord state in Western Siberia. Occupying the territory of the former Omsk Oblast, it borders Tomsk to the north, the Kazakh SSR to the south, Tyumen to the east, and Novosibirsk to the west.

Following the dissolution of the Soviet Union , the city of Omsk, initially held by the West Siberian People's Republic , was seized by a league of ultranationalists sharing views of anti-German sentiment and revanchism. Led by Dmitry Karbyshev 's All-Russian Black League, upon the seizing of Omsk, the ultranationalist regime had to industrialize and fortify it. In a way, some could say it's nothing but a fortified city in which the Black League militarizes and prepares for its future conflicts.

The political system of Omsk is governed as a militarist one-party state since its founding, ruled by Karbyshev and his like-minded comrades of the All-Russian Black League, an organization fanatically devoted to revanchism against the Greater Germanic Reich . However, at heart, Karbyshev is a Russian and while he sought to create an ultranationalist military state to take revenge against Germany, he did not account for the despots that wished to claim as much power as possible from him. Karbyshev is represented in-game as a dying man soon to fall, due to him leading a brutal military dictatorship, while being opposed to the radical rhetoric of his officer clique. The Black League has since become an ultranationalist state, even more radical in their hatred of Germany. Due to Karbyshev's declining health, many of the other officers have gained massive influence in the leadership of Omsk. The reality is that Karbyshev started a movement that assumed it was able to change the hearts of the despots with nationalism rather than terror; but it has since been corrupted beyond his visions, and there is little he can do to stop the train of degeneracy. Indeed, once Karbyshev dies and Omsk is still around, actual ultranationalist and General Dmitry Yazov will assume leadership of the Black League and prevent the despotic cliques from growing.

Under the sheer doctrine of anti-German sentiment, the theory of the “Great Trial” in Omsk comes in. This is where the warlord state will prepare for its final assault on the Reich, as revenge for the “First Trial” which brought the dissolution of the Soviet Union and the “Second Trial” being the West Russian War . Their hatred doesn't stop with just Germany, but it includes many who collaborated with them. Some officers of the Black League even go as far as to want to destroy the United States for not helping enough during the Great Patriotic War. In preparation for their war with Germany, they are expectant of nuclear strikes and so have started to construct massive metro tunnels to double as shelter from the warheads and radioactive fallout. The resolve of the Black League cannot be stopped, even with the threat of nuclear war.

Omsk is one of the hardest paths in TNO, due to it being weaker than a lot of the surrounding warlords and being unable to conduct diplomacy at all. To reunite Russia, Omsk will have to fight every single state in its way. Their end goal is the complete extermination of the Reich and the German people, and they will stop at nothing to reach this. They are hard-coded for hostility and are always at war with someone, but an AI Omsk will almost always never be successful. Despite being founded on nothing but hatred, when they unify Western Siberia and start to emerge on the international stage, they actually try to conceal their ideology and ambitions from foreign influences. They stick with a nondescript name of the “West Siberian Provisional Authority” under the guise of a protective military authority and switch their ideology to “Despotism”.

  • Ironically, according to a former developer of West Siberia, Omsk at one point had a National Socialist path as a "sane" option, due to now-former head developer Pink Panzer wanting every region in Western Siberia to have multiple paths. This was changed after the other developers convinced him to have Omsk only have one path.
  • Omsk was partially inspired by the Armenian Secret Army for the Liberation of Armenia , a militant group that aspired to carve out an ethnic Armenian homeland in eastern Turkey.
